WebThe DPA 2024 sets out the data protection framework in the UK, alongside the UK GDPR. It contains three separate data protection regimes: Part 2: sets out a general processing regime (the UK GDPR); Part 3: sets out a separate regime for law enforcement authorities; and; Part 4: sets out a separate regime for the three intelligence services. WebOct 15, 2024 · The Data Protection Act 2024 already allows this for the public interest purposes specified in Schedule 2. Allowing a general public interest override to purpose limitation will significantly weaken protections for individuals, so it would be useful to understand the size of the problem that DCMS thinks it is addressing with this proposal.

WebNew to the GDPR: The size of the sanctions are significant. Organisations that violate the law may face sanctions of up to the higher amount of 4% of their global sales (the last 12 months) or € 20 million.
